Fact Check: "The Earth is flat"

What We Know

The claim that "the Earth is flat" is a widely debunked assertion that contradicts centuries of scientific evidence. Historical observations, such as those made by the ancient Greeks and Egyptians, demonstrated the Earth's curvature through the study of celestial movements and shadows cast by the sun at different locations (NASA). Furthermore, modern space exploration has provided direct visual evidence of the Earth's spherical shape, as seen in photographs taken from space (NASA).

Scientific consensus supports the understanding that the Earth is an oblate spheroid, a fact corroborated by various fields of study, including astronomy, physics, and geography (Wikipedia). The Flat Earth theory is often rooted in a misunderstanding of scientific principles and is fueled by confirmation bias, where individuals selectively interpret information to support their beliefs (Maselli & Mourad).

Analysis

The assertion that the Earth is flat lacks credible scientific support and is contradicted by overwhelming evidence. For instance, the ancient Greeks calculated the Earth's circumference using the angles of shadows cast by the sun at different latitudes, leading to the conclusion that the Earth is round (NASA). Additionally, during the age of exploration, navigators relied on the spherical model of the Earth to successfully circumnavigate the globe, which would not have been possible if the Earth were flat (NASA).

The Flat Earth theory is often propagated by individuals and groups who may not have a strong foundation in scientific literacy. This is evident in the way that proponents of the theory often ignore or misinterpret scientific data (Interesting Engineering). The sources promoting the flat Earth perspective are generally considered unreliable and often lack rigorous scientific backing. In contrast, reputable sources such as NASA and educational institutions provide extensive documentation and evidence supporting the spherical nature of the Earth.

Conclusion

Verdict: False
The claim that "the Earth is flat" is unequivocally false. It is contradicted by a vast body of scientific evidence and historical observations that demonstrate the Earth's spherical shape. The persistence of this belief can largely be attributed to cognitive biases and misinformation rather than credible scientific inquiry.
